Default Radiohead Announce North American Tour, Finally!

from pitchfork:

"Amy Phillips reports:
At last! Real, honest-to-goodness, confirmed Radiohead North American tour dates! I'm going to explode!

Looks like all of the rumors were true: the two-night stands, the intimate theaters, the Chicago and San Fran dates. Tickets for most shows go on sale May 5 and 6; see below for more details.

According to a press release, "set lists for the shows will draw heavily on the newer material the band has been working on over the past months. The performances will take place in smaller than usual venues, and will feature appropriately scaled down staging and lighting design, creating a suitably intimate environment for the first ever airings of several new songs."
